Assessing Pricing and Packages

Pricing for photography in Orlando differs based on experience, session length, deliverables, and services offered together. Usual pricing structures include hourly rates, flat fees for specific packages, or tiered pricing depending on add-ons like prints or albums.

Usually, portrait sessions may range from a hundreds of dollars for a quick family shoot to more for extended sessions or specialty locations. Wedding photography often comes in packages that cover the full day with options for engagement sessions and albums. Commercial shoots might be priced by project scope, including pre-shoot consultations and post-production.

When reviewing costs, look beyond the sticker price. Factors such as turnaround time, number of edited images, and included products are crucial. Organizing Your Photography Shoot

Scheduling Your Photography Location and Time

Choosing the ideal location and timing for your photography session can significantly affect your photo outcomes. Orlando features an abundance of choices, from city locations in downtown Orlando to serene natural sceneries in Wekiwa Springs or Lake Butler.

Think about the atmosphere you desire: Is it relaxed and playful or sophisticated and traditional? Each setting features unique visual aspects such as vibrant plants, architectural details, or waterfront backdrops. Nearby cities like Winter Park or Maitland also include appealing districts and recreational areas that many photographers advise.

When you schedule depends heavily on lighting. The golden hours—shortly after sunrise or before sunset—deliver soft, warm light that is perfect for portraits and outdoor couples’ shoots. Remember the Florida seasons as well; the cooler months from November to April generally experience more enjoyable temperatures and clearer skies compared to the frequently hot and sticky summer.
